Output 658269ecabca7c4f3fb81ab2af0e06cd07a9ebc94b19fa58cc8edf56acc0e57c:0

value
12800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 deb91689f8079f252e4019a2a883a39b76f25af935c0c6156107e23ae929bfdf
address
ltc1pm6u3dz0cq70j2tjqrx323qarndm0ykhexhqvv9tpql3r46ffhl0sm6u9eh
transaction
658269ecabca7c4f3fb81ab2af0e06cd07a9ebc94b19fa58cc8edf56acc0e57c
spent
true